A bell siphon is a simple yet powerful tool used in aquaponics systems to regulate the flood and drain cycle of a grow bed. It works by automatically draining water once it reaches a certain level, ensuring that plant roots get both the hydration and oxygen they need for healthy growth. When functioning properly, a bell siphon helps maintain a balanced environment that supports both plant and fish life.

Common Bell Siphon Problems and What Causes Them
Understanding the common bell siphon issues is the first step in diagnosing and fixing your system. Most problems can be traced back to setup inconsistencies or water flow imbalances. Below, we break down the most frequent bell siphon problems, what causes them, and what you can do to address them.
1. Bell Siphon Not Starting
One of the most frustrating issues growers face is a bell siphon not starting. This means the siphon fails to trigger the draining cycle, and water just continues to rise in the grow bed. This disrupts the flood-and-drain rhythm essential to healthy plant growth.
Common causes include:
-
Inadequate Water Flow:
If the flow rate into the grow bed is too low, the siphon can’t create enough suction to trigger the drain. A weak inflow means the water level rises too slowly or never reaches the critical height needed to start the siphon.
-
Incorrect Standpipe Height:
The standpipe determines when the siphon activates. If it’s too short or too tall relative to the bell and grow bed depth, it can cause inconsistent starting behavior or prevent the siphon from triggering altogether.
-
Air Leaks in the Bell Cap:
A loose or cracked bell cap can allow air to enter the system, which interrupts the vacuum needed to initiate the siphon. Ensuring a tight seal is key.
2. Bell Siphon Not Draining Completely
Another common issue is a bell siphon not draining or draining only partially before stopping. This can leave standing water in your grow bed, which may cause root rot and disrupt the system’s oxygenation cycle.
Likely causes include:
-
Incorrect Placement of Grow Bed Media:
If media is blocking the base of the siphon or media guard, it can restrict water flow and prevent full drainage.
-
Insufficient Drop Pipe Length:
The drop pipe beneath the standpipe helps maintain suction during draining. If it’s too short, the siphon will break before the bed is empty.
-
Blockage in the Outflow Pipe:
Debris, roots, or buildup in the outflow pipe can slow water movement and stop the siphon before full drainage occurs. Regular inspection and cleaning help prevent this.
3. Bell Siphon Constantly Draining (Won’t Stop)
If your system seems to be constantly draining without cycling properly, you’re likely dealing with a bell siphon failure. This condition often results in a continuous trickle or flow of water, preventing the flood stage from occurring.
Main causes include:
-
Water Flow Too High:
An overly strong inflow can overpower the siphon’s ability to break, resulting in continuous draining. This is especially common with high-capacity pumps or systems without flow control valves.
-
Incorrect Bell Height:
If the bell is too short or not properly sized compared to the standpipe and grow bed depth, the system won't reach the right pressure differential needed to shut off the siphon.
-
Missing or Broken Seal:
A small seal or reducer bushing is often used at the bottom of the standpipe to help form the siphon. If it’s missing, cracked, or poorly fitted, the siphon may never fully engage or break properly.
Step-by-Step Guide: How to Fix Bell Siphon Issues
When your bell siphon isn’t working correctly, it’s tempting to think something is seriously broken, but in most cases, a few adjustments are all it takes. Follow this DIY bell siphon fix guide to restore proper operation and get your aquaponics system flowing smoothly again
Step 1 – Check and Adjust Water Flow Rate
Water flow is the heartbeat of a properly functioning bell siphon. If it's too low, the siphon won’t trigger. If it’s too high, it might never stop draining.
What to do:
- Observe the inflow: Ensure water is entering the grow bed at a steady, moderate pace, not too slow or aggressive.
- Install a flow control valve on the pump line to fine-tune water delivery.
- Watch for proper flooding: The grow bed should fill at a predictable rate, triggering the siphon consistently once it reaches the standpipe height.
Tip:A good starting point is to aim for a complete flood cycle every 15–30 minutes, depending on your bed size.
Step 2 – Inspect the Bell Siphon Assembly
A misaligned or poorly sealed bell siphon will almost always cause performance issues.
What to check:
- Bell placement: Make sure the bell is centered over the standpipe and fits snugly within the media guard (if used).
- Bell cap and top seal:Inspect for cracks, warping, or gaps where air could enter, any breach here can prevent siphon activation.
- Tight connections: Ensure the standpipe is securely fastened to the bulkhead fitting.
A properly sealed and aligned bell siphon maintains the vacuum pressure necessary for consistent cycling.
Step 3 – Examine the Standpipe and Bell Dimensions
Size matters when it comes to siphon reliability. Improper ratios between the bell, standpipe, and grow bed depth can throw everything off.
Guidelines:
- Standpipe height should be slightly shorter than the desired maximum water level in your grow bed (usually 1–2 inches below the surface).
- Bell height should fully cover the standpipe with 1–2 inches of clearance at the top.
- Bell diameter should be about 1.5–2x wider than the standpipe to maintain proper suction.
Adjust as needed based on your system’s flow rate and grow bed depth.
Step 4 – Clear Any Blockages
Clogs are a common and easily overlooked issue, especially in mature systems.
Here’s what to do:
- Inspect the media guard: Remove any roots, clay pebbles, or biofilm that may be clogging the flow.
- Flush the outflow pipe: Debris or sediment buildup here can interrupt drainage and cause the siphon to fail mid-cycle.
- Clean your standpipe: Algae, slime, or particles can stick to the interior and reduce performance over time.
Perform regular cleaning as part of your routine aquaponics maintenance schedule.
Tips for Preventing Future Bell Siphon Problems
Once your bell siphon is back on track, a few smart habits can help you avoid future disruptions. Consider this part of your ongoing bell siphon troubleshooting and troubleshooting aquaponics system routine.
1. Maintain a consistent inflow rate:
Use a pump with a stable output and consider a timer or flow controller to prevent pressure surges.
2.Install a media guard:
This prevents grow media, roots, and debris from entering the siphon area and causing clogs.
3.Choose the right bell siphon size:
Match your siphon to the size and depth of your grow bed, undersized or oversized parts can lead to siphon instability.
4.Clean your system regularly:
Biofilm, algae, and waste can collect in pipes and fittings over time, reducing flow and increasing the chance of failure.
5.Avoid using fine grow media:
Materials like sand or fine gravel can easily enter the siphon system and block flow. Stick to expanded clay or coarse gravel for best results.

When to Replace Your Bell Siphon: Signs of Failure
Even with proper maintenance and troubleshooting, some bell siphons eventually reach the end of their functional life. Knowing when it’s time to stop adjusting and start replacing can save you hours of frustration and restore optimal system performance. Below are the most common indicators of bell siphon failure, along with practical bell siphon problems and solutions to help you decide when a replacement is the right move.
1. Cracks or Air Leaks in the Bell or Cap
The bell and cap must form an airtight seal to create the vacuum necessary for proper siphoning. Over time, plastic components may become brittle, warped, or cracked due to UV exposure, water pressure, or wear and tear.
What to look for:
- Visible cracks, pinholes, or warping in the bell chamber or cap
- Air bubbles appearing inside the siphon during operation (a sign of a broken seal)
- Difficulty maintaining suction even after resealing or adjusting components
Solution:
If sealing with waterproof tape or replacing the cap doesn’t resolve the issue, it’s time to replace the bell siphon with a new, more durable unit.
2. Persistent Siphon Failure Even After Adjustments
If you’ve tried all the standard fixes, adjusting the inflow, checking dimensions, clearing blockages, and the siphon still won't operate correctly, you may be facing a full mechanical failure.
Symptoms of persistent failure:
- The bell siphon not starting, or taking too long to trigger
- The system constantly draining without cycling
- Inconsistent performance across multiple flood and drain cycles
Solution:
This is often a sign that the internal dimensions or material integrity of your siphon have degraded. The most effective solution here is replacement, especially if you’ve already spent significant time on bell siphon troubleshooting without consistent results.
3. Outdated or Poorly Built Siphon Materials
Not all siphons are created equal. DIY siphons made from subpar materials or repurposed fittings may not withstand long-term use, especially in outdoor or high-throughput systems.
Common issues with low-quality siphons:
- Inflexible or brittle plastic that easily cracks
- Misaligned fittings that don’t seal properly
- Inconsistent dimensions that throw off siphon timing
Solution:
If your current siphon was made from questionable parts or isn’t rated for aquaponics use, it’s worth investing in a well-designed commercial siphon or rebuilding yours with aquaponics-grade PVC and fittings.

Bell Siphon Troubleshooting FAQs
Below are some of the most frequently asked questions about bell siphon troubleshooting, with simple, actionable answers to help you fix the problem fast.
1. Why isn’t my bell siphon starting?
A bell siphon usually won’t start because the water flow into the grow bed is too slow, the standpipe height is incorrect, or there’s an air leak in the bell or cap.
Common Causes and Quick Fixes:
- Inadequate water flow: Increase pump rate or adjust flow with a valve.
- Incorrect standpipe height:Ensure the standpipe reaches just below the top water level.
- Air leaks: Check for cracks or loose caps on the bell; reseal or replace if needed.
- Grow bed filling too slowly:Make sure your pump fills the bed within 15–30 minutes for ideal siphon activation.
2. How do I stop my bell siphon from constantly draining?
If your bell siphon is constantly draining, the water flow is likely too high, the bell height is incorrect, or there’s a broken seal disrupting the siphon break.
Possible Solutions Explained Simply:
- Reduce water inflow using a control valve to slow the flood rate.
- Check bell height: Make sure the bell is tall enough to fully cover the standpipe.
- Inspect the siphon seal: Look for a missing reducer bushing or loose fittings.
- Add a breather tube or air break to help the siphon break properly after draining.
3. How do I know if my bell siphon is too small or large for my system?
Your bell siphon may be too small if it cycles inconsistently or can’t maintain suction. If it’s too large, it may never start or drain properly.
General Sizing Guidelines:
Grow Bed Size |
Recommended Standpipe Diameter |
Bell Diameter |
Bell Height |
< 20 gallons |
¾ inch |
1.5–2 inch |
6–8 inches |
20–50 gallons |
1 inch |
2–3 inch |
8–10 inches |
50–100 gallons |
1.5 inch |
3–4 inch |
10–12 inches |
General Rules:
- The bell should be 1.5x to 2x the diameter of the standpipe.
- The bell height should fully cover the standpipe and allow for air pocket formation at the top.
- The grow bed should drain in 5–10 minutes and flood in 15–30 minutes for a well-balanced cycle.
